Celtic made £8.8m offer to sign Timothy Castagne
Celtic made an offer of £8.8 million for Atalanta defender Timothy Castagne during the January window.
Sky Italy’s Gianluca Di Marzio has confirmed that Celtic made a big offer to sign the Belgian but ultimately missed out on his services.
Castagne was one of Celtic’s key targets during the January window, with Brendan Rodgers keen to strengthen defensively.
The right-back position was one area in particular that the club had been looking to address.
Mikael Lustig and Cristian Gamboa are both approaching the end of their contracts with the club and neither have done enough in recent months to warrant new deals.

It became clear that Celtic would be priced out of a deal to sign Castagne in the new year, despite their respectable offer.
The Hoops instead moved on to German defender Jeremy Toljan, who joined the club on loan from Borussia Dortmund until the end of the season.
